Subject: DR drill Thursday — report exports

Hi team, quick heads-up: Thursday's disaster-recovery drill will fail over the Harbrook export service. During the window, scheduled report exports may stamp timestamps in UTC instead of customer-local time — that's expected, just note it on any tickets. To restore the export scheduler after failback, unseal the config store with the passphrase below.

recovery phrase for fawif-tajeg: norael-aldmir-casir-brivan-ulaion

For security review purposes: pre-warmed instances retain decrypted config in memory for up to ten minutes, and the warming scheduler runs under the `runtime-warm` service role. Changes to warming policy, secret handling at init, or the provisioned-concurrency tiers require sign-off from the platform leads. Audit logs for init-phase activity are retained ninety days. For questions about cold-start security posture or to request log access, contact the team below.

alerts address for bajop-yahog: istwyn@lumiclabs.internal

Subject: TideFrame widget cut-over — done

Cut-over completed 03:10 last night. Old Moorgate endpoint is dark; all traffic now hits the TideFrame v2 service. Harbor predictions validated against the Pellworth sample set — no regressions. One hiccup: cache warmup took longer than planned, extended the window by eight minutes. Dashboards green since 04:00. Rollback plan stays live for 72 hours. For the record, the service came up with the configuration listed below.

settings of kajep-kawip:
[zorys]
host = zorys.urlaqgrid.corp
user = zorys_svc
database = zorys_prod

Test Plan Note — Orlin ORM Refactor

Scope: replace the legacy Orlin data mapper with the new Fennic repository layer. Regression suite covers CRUD paths, lazy-load edge cases, and transaction rollback behavior. Migration runs against a snapshot of the Westbrook dataset; no production writes. Pass criteria: zero schema drift, query count within 5% of baseline. Release manager should hold the tag until suite run 3 is green. CI agents need the staging credential below to execute.

session JWT of yawep-yawep = eyJhbGciOiJIUzI1NiIsInR5cCI6IkpXVCJ9.eyJzdWIiOiI3pWF3_In0.aXYsHiog